At CES 2026, Nvidia launched Alpamayo, a brand new household of open supply AI fashions, simulation instruments, and datasets for coaching bodily robots and automobiles which can be designed to assist autonomous automobiles cause by way of advanced driving conditions.
“The ChatGPT second for bodily AI is right here – when machines start to grasp, cause, and act in the actual world,” Nvidia CEO Jensen Huang stated in a press release. “Alpamayo brings reasoning to autonomous automobiles, permitting them to suppose by way of uncommon situations, drive safely in advanced environments, and clarify their driving choices.”
On the core of Nvidia’s new household is Alpamayo 1, a ten billion-parameter chain-of-thought, reason-based imaginative and prescient language motion (VLA) mannequin that enables an AV to suppose extra like a human so it could actually clear up advanced edge circumstances — like how you can navigate a visitors gentle outage at a busy intersection — with out earlier expertise.
“It does this by breaking down issues into steps, reasoning by way of each chance, after which deciding on the most secure path,” Ali Kani, Nvidia’s vice chairman of automotive, stated Monday throughout a press briefing.
Or as Huang put it throughout his keynote on Monday: “Not solely does [Alpamayo] take sensor enter and activate steering wheel, brakes, and acceleration, it additionally causes about what motion it’s about to take. It tells you what motion it’s going to take, the explanations by which it took place that motion. After which, after all, the trajectory.”
Alpamayo 1’s underlying code is accessible on Hugging Face. Builders can fine-tune Alpamayo into smaller, quicker variations for car improvement, use it to coach less complicated driving programs, or construct instruments on prime of it like auto-labeling programs that mechanically tag video knowledge or evaluators that test if a automotive made a good move.
“They’ll additionally use Cosmos to generate artificial knowledge after which practice and check their Alpamayo-based AV utility on the mix of the actual and artificial dataset,” Kani stated. Cosmos is Nvidia’s model of generative world fashions, AI programs that create a illustration of a bodily setting to allow them to make predictions and take actions.

As a part of the Alpamayo rollout, Nvidia can be releasing an open dataset with greater than 1,700 hours of driving knowledge collected throughout a spread of geographies and situations, masking uncommon and complicated real-world situations. The corporate is moreover launching AlpaSim, an open supply simulation framework for validating autonomous driving programs. Out there on GitHub, AlpaSim is designed to recreate real-world driving situations, from sensors to visitors, so builders can safely check programs at scale.
